Job requirements of hotel street sleepers

Sleepers' work seems simple, but it also takes a lot of time and energy. They must look for a new hotel first. At first, they always looked for hotels online when they woke up every day, and it took more than ten hours to find them. When they visit, they must spend a certain amount of manpower and financial resources, which requires meticulous and patience. Hotel sleepers generally don't just find a hotel experience, and business travel and tourism are their main experience orientations.

Not only do you need to make a lot of preparations before going to bed, but you must also observe the details of each hotel you stay in and describe the accommodation experience with a lot of words, pictures and videos.

Before entering the hotel, pay attention to whether a waiter opens the door; After entering the hotel, pay attention to how long it takes to check in and whether the elevator entrance is easy to find. Interestingly, the smell of the hotel lobby should also be recorded, because good star-rated hotels will spray perfume, and the smell of different hotels is different, which is highly valued by high-end business people.

Hotel sleepers will take photos with their mobile phones after checking into their rooms as ordinary guests. The number of towels in the bathroom, the speed of spraying hot water, the cleanliness of sheets in the room, the location of sockets and the number of sockets should all be reflected in the video, and the illustrated way is the most popular among the public. Generally speaking, after uploading the video, you should write a diary to describe more details that the video may not present, such as the service attitude of hotel staff and the situation when you check in. Although some hotels are a little worried about uninvited guests like "hotel sleepers", they still welcome hotels with confident service.

In addition, some experienced hotel operators believe that the in-depth comments and interactions of hotel testers are also helpful to highlight the brand management characteristics of chain hotels that have formed brand-scale operations, promote all kinds of hotels to break away from the simple price competition of homogenization, and form the development path of differentiated services.

In addition, some experts said that there are many comment systems in the hotel service field, but in the general comment system, the comment mechanism often has some negative effects: for example, it may produce false comments or malicious attacks from competitors, which will also bring a lot of misleading to the majority of users. However, through the professional evaluation model of "hotel sleepers" in Qunar.com, hotel sleepers will be responsible for their professional quality and employers, so the fairness and objectivity of the evaluation will be reliably guaranteed. Chen Wei, deputy director of China Tianjin Human Resources Development Service Center, believes that "hotel critic" is the embryonic form of a new profession, but it may also be just a hype of merchants. Now it can only be regarded as a new post, not a new occupation, because it has not been tested for a long time, and there is no specific national standard. The "hotel taster" is similar to the high-paying cosmetic model that just appeared in the shopping mall. This new job of trying to live and install is similar to quality supervision in nature, and should be welcomed from the public's point of view, because it is beneficial to mass consumers. However, there are many immature places in these new positions, which may bring troubles to candidates, such as what to do if the skin reacts when trying cosmetics, what to do if there are accidents such as bumps in hotels, etc. Are these all work-related injuries? Therefore, job seekers should carefully look at whether there are detailed job descriptions and requirements in the recruitment information, rationally choose a new "career", and don't blindly "blindly" believe in the concept introduced by merchants.
